Botswana’s New First Lady Kneels Before Husband During His Inauguration Ceremony

Botswana’s first lady, Kaone Boko kneels before husband as a sign of respect.

This was during the inauguration ceremony of her husband Advocate Duma Boko who was being sworn in as the 6th President of Botswana.

The inauguration ceremony took place at Gaborone on 8th November 2024 where the president took his oath.

First lady Kaone Boko kneels before husband, President Duma Boko during the inauguration ceremony.

During the inauguration, his wife who was dressed in a light purple dress was seen kneeling before him as a sign of respect and love towards the President.

I will maintain the constitution of Botswana and uphold the laws, and that I will direct my abilities to the service and welfare of the people without fear or Favour, affection or ill-will. So, help me God.

President Duma Boko said as he took his oath of office at the office of the chief justice three days after elections.

During his acceptance speech, the president said that he wanted to secure investor confidence as well as ties with mining companies active in Botswana while exploring ways to diversify the diamond-dependent economy, a measure seen as critical to stabilizing the country’s finance.
